One important facet of law enforcement that frequently sparks discussion among legal experts, civil rights activists, & the general public is warrantless arrests. These arrests take place when police officers hold someone without first securing a judge or magistrate's warrant. The practice stems from the need for police to respond quickly when a warrant could jeopardize public safety or enable a suspect to avoid capture. On the other hand, the consequences of such measures call into question how to strike a balance between individual rights protection and efficient law enforcement. For employees navigating the challenges of job loss & transition, it is essential to comprehend the subtleties of separation pay. Separation pay eligibility usually depends on a number of variables, such as the type of employment relationship, the cause of termination, and the employer's particular policies. Separation pay is generally more likely to be awarded to workers who are let go for organizational reorganizations or economic reasons. Employees who lose their jobs due to misconduct or poor performance, on the other hand, might not be eligible for this benefit. The length of service of an employee frequently has a big impact on eligibility, in addition to the reason for termination.

Dangerous drugs refers to a broad category of substances that are considered detrimental to both individuals and society as a whole. Narcotics, stimulants, hallucinogens, and other substances that can cause physical or psychological dependence are all considered dangerous drugs under RA 9165. These drugs are categorized by the law into various schedules according to their therapeutic value & potential for abuse; Schedule I substances are the most restricted because of their high potential for addiction and lack of recognized medical use.

Republic Act No.. 9165, commonly referred to as the Comprehensive Dangerous Drugs Act of 2002, is a noteworthy law in the Philippines that attempts to address the widespread problem of drug trafficking and illegal use. Outlining the legal framework for prosecuting those found in possession of dangerous drugs, Section 11 of the law addresses this issue specifically among its many provisions. Law enforcement and the general public both depend on this section to comprehend the legal repercussions of drug possession. When prompt action is required, such as to stop an ongoing crime or stop a suspect from escaping, warrantless arrests can be extremely important. Requiring officers to get warrants in every situation, according to supporters, could make it more difficult for them to react quickly to dangerous situations, possibly endangering lives. Advocates further claim that by enabling police to take prompt action in response to suspicious activity, warrantless arrests can aid in deterring crime. For example, having the ability to make an arrest right away if an officer sees someone breaking into a car or using drugs can stop more crimes and improve community safety. This viewpoint highlights how law enforcement must continue to operate with flexibility while upholding the legal requirements intended to safeguard the rights of the public. However, those who oppose warrantless arrests express serious worries about how they may affect due process & civil liberties.

An officer may have good reason to make an arrest without a warrant, for instance, if they see a suspect committing a violent crime or escaping the scene of an incident. Officers may also act without a warrant under the exigent circumstances exception if there is an urgent need to save lives, stop a suspect from escaping, or stop evidence from being destroyed. This legal framework seeks to achieve a balance between the defense of individual rights & the need for prompt law enforcement action. Law enforcement agencies' potential abuse and overreach are the main causes of the controversy surrounding the practice of warrantless arrests.

One prominent instance was in 2014, when Ferguson, Missouri, police were widely criticized for using violent tactics during demonstrations in the wake of Michael Brown's shooting. Officers frequently targeted people based on their presence rather than any particular criminal behavior, making a large number of warrantless arrests during these protests. Tensions between the community and law enforcement were heightened as a result of allegations of racial profiling and excessive force. A sequence of warrantless arrests made by police in New York City during the enforcement of stop-and-frisk policies is another instance that highlights the possibility of abuse.

One of the main arguments against this practice is that it can result in arbitrary detentions without adequate explanation, which would violate the fundamental rule that people shouldn't be denied their freedom without following the proper legal procedures. Critics contend that this oversight gap may lead to erroneous arrests and worsen already-existing disparities in the criminal justice system. A growing amount of evidence also indicates that marginalized communities are disproportionately impacted by warrantless arrests. Research indicates that racial minorities & those from lower socioeconomic backgrounds are more likely to be arrested in this way, which raises concerns about institutionalized bias in law enforcement procedures. It may become more difficult for law enforcement to effectively serve and protect all citizens as a result of this disproportionate impact, which can also erode community trust in the police.
